Title Note

Personnel: Clay Walker (vocals, guitar); Jimmy Ritchey (acoustic & electric guitars, nylon & gut string acoustic guitars, banjo); B. James Lowry, Biff Watson (acoustic guitar); David Grisson, Brent Mason (electric guitar); Paul Franklin (steel guitar); Jonathan Yudkin (banjo, violin, fiddle, viola, cello, harp); Aubrey Haynie (mandolin, fiddle); Kirl "Jelly Roll" Johnson (chromatic harp); Tim Akers (keyboards); Samuel B. Levine (tenor saxophone); Jim Horn (baritone saxophone); Steve Patrick (trumpet); Chris Dunn (trombone); Leland Sklar (bass); Shannon Forrest (drums); Eric Darken (percussion); Lisa Cochran, Melodie Crittenden, Wes Hightower (background vocals).

Recorded at Ocean Way Nashville, The Money Pit, Black Bird Studio, and Loud Studios, Nashville, Tennessee.

Clay Walker emerged in the post-Garth era of country music, and while he's not unmarked by that sensibility, he's also got a little of the Randy Travis-style balladeer in him. In fact, instead of opening with an up-tempo, hook-heavy song, A FEW QUESTIONS starts with its soul-searching title track, which finds Walker inquiring of God for the reasons why people suffer--not the sort of thing you'd expect from a guy whose sole writing credit on the album is "Jesus Was a Country Boy." Walker rocks out a bit on the roadhouse chugger "I'm in the Mood for You" and with the blues-rock swagger of "Coming Back Again," showing that he's just as adept at moving and shaking as he is at broken-hearted crooning. At the time of this album's release, Walker had already been a consistent hit-maker for 10 years, with little to prove, but that didn't slow the Clay Walker success train down a single bit.
